Post by fatacon » Sun Jul 13, 2008 04:03

not sure if this was changed or not but...

#5: only forward guard cancel rolls would register towards the 5 required, backward guard cancel rolls did not

#7: you only have to chain a normal, command move, and special. i used s.A, f+A, qcb+A (aka Iori's default macro) and it passed somehow.

i've only started on challenge so i suppose i'll post more if i find anything. that is, unless everybody knows this stuff already.
